Rules & Grading Scale

Rules of the Room

9th Grade Science

Room 305

Mr. Redel

 

  1. Be in your assigned seat with all needed materials when the bell rings.
    1. You will be recorded as tardy

1.      Warning

2.      15 min detention AM  (7:45)

3.      30 min detention  AM  (2 of 15 min.)

4.      Office Referral

  1. No purses or backpacks on the top of your desk/lab table.  Hands must be visible above the desk/table level, not in a hoodie / pocket etc.
  1. Follow directions  THE FIRST TIME !

 

  1. Show pride in room and respect for those in it.  Keep it clean, be polite and respectful, use proper language.  Show courtesy and respect towards every person. 

 

  1. No – food –pop-gum-water-gatorade etc.  We will have a water break about mid-class. 
  2. Grading
    1. A – 90-100
    2. B – 89-80
    3. C – 79-70
    4. D – 69-60
    5. F – 59 and below
  3. Extra credit –will rarely be given – special times during class discussions or materials to help with class management. NOT GIVEN TO HELP RAISE A POOR GRADE!!!!
  4. Speak when it is your turn, by getting permissionRAISE YOUR HAND AND WAIT TO BE CALLED ON!!!!!!  The teacher will be called “Mr or “Coach”  Redel
  5. Make up work will be done or arranged to be done within 2 class periods or it will go in the grade book as a zero.   It is your responsibility to get your assignment turned in or completed on time.
  6. Safety first – follow all safety rules when we are doing a lab. FOLLOW DIRECTIONS!!!!
    1. 1 - removal from lab and 2 – 15 min. detentions before school
    2. 2 - removal from class until meet with parents and principal.
    3. 3 - Removal from class take the class over in the future.
  7. Cell Phones: No cell phones in class.
    1. First offense – pick up after school – remember I have coaching duties right after school each day!
    2. Second offense – must pick up with your parents (see above)
    3. Third Offense – pick up with parents in the office and an office referral.
